Comprehending Audi Keys
Audi keys have come a long method from conventional mechanical keys. Modern Audi vehicles are geared up with intelligent key fobs that offer keyless entry and innovative security functions. Here's a breakdown of the types of keys utilized in Audi cars:
Key TypeDescriptionStandard KeyA standard metal key utilized in older Audi designs without sophisticated innovation.Transponder KeyFeatures a chip inside the key that communicates with the car's ignition system for improved security.Smart Key/ Key FobOffers keyless entry and push-button start innovation, often with additional features like remote start.Valet KeyA restricted gain access to key that enables entry to the lorry however restricts access to the trunk and glove compartment.Why You Might Need a Replacement Key

Replacing an Audi key is not as straightforward as visiting your regional hardware shop. The process can be broken down into numerous actions:
Step 1: Identify Your Key Type
Before continuing with a replacement, identify your key type as laid out in the table above. Knowing this guarantees you follow the right procedure.
Step 2: Gather Required Documentation
To replace your Audi key, you'll require to supply certain documents to show ownership. These usually include: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)Proof of Ownership: Title, registration, or purchase agreementRecognition: Driver's license or government-issued IDStep 3: Contact an Audi Dealer or Locksmith
You have 2 primary choices for key replacement:

Authorized Audi Dealer: This choice is typically more pricey but assurances O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ts and services. The dealership can set the new key for you.

Certified Locksmith: Some locksmith professionals concentrate on chip keys and fobs. They might provide more competitive rates than dealers, however ensure they have an excellent track record and the needed devices for your key type.
Step 4: Programming the New Key
As soon as you have the new key, it needs to be programmed to work with your Audi. Both dealerships and certified locksmith professionals can program your key, but the process may differ depending on the design year and key type. Smart keys, in specific, might need specific programming devices.
Step 5: Testing the New Key
After programming, constantly test the new key to guarantee it works properly with your vehicle. This includes testing the keyless entry, ignition, and any extra functions connected with clever keys.
Key Replacement Costs
The cost of changing Audi keys can vary significantly based upon several aspects, including the type of key, the mode of replacement (dealership vs. locksmith professional), and your place. Below is a cost breakdown to give you an approximation:
Key TypeTypical CostDealer/LocksmithStandard Key₤ 50 - ₤ 100EitherTransponder Key₤ 100 - ₤ 300Dealership more suitableSmart Key/ Key Fob₤ 250 - ₤ 600Dealership more suitableValet Key₤ 50 - ₤ 150Either
Keep in mind: These are typical price quotes and can vary based on elements like area, design, and service supplier.

Can I replace my Audi key without the initial?
In many cases, you will need the initial key or at least proof of ownership to get a replacement. However, some locksmiths might offer services that help unlock the car without the initial, enabling for a new key to be made.
2. The length of time will it require to get a replacement key?
The time it takes to replace an Audi key can differ. If you go through a dealership, you might require to wait a few days for the new key to be delivered, whereas a locksmith professional might be able to develop a new key on the spot, consisting of programming.
3. What if I lose my smart key?
If you lose your smart key, get in touch with a certified locksmith professional or your Audi dealer right away. They can disable the lost key to prevent unauthorized access and develop a new one for you.
4. Exist guarantees on replacement keys?
Some dealers and locksmith professionals might offer limited guarantees on replacement keys or programming services. Always inquire about warranties when scheduling a replacement.
